Latest Patents

Among his latest innovations is a patented "Chair with Ergonomic Motion Features." This chair design includes a seat pan member and a seat back member that features a unique lumbar support member. The lumbar support assembly is engineered to facilitate movement of the lumbar member in relation to the seat pan and back, allowing for improved support of the user's lower back. This innovative design helps users maintain a forward seating position while benefiting from the lumbar support, thereby enhancing the overall sitting experience.
